    Unless he has been added, he was not on the roster, but is fine to be in camp. I'm not sure he is any color shirt.

    I suppose he could be red shirted w/out being on the roster.

    Gray shirt means he would have to delay enrollment or limit hours taken (not a full time student)

    Green shirts enroll early and are expected to play immediately

    Blue shirt is very complicated and I don't think he fell under that one.

    Like I said. Confusing as to what he actually is.

    Arkansas averaged 268 yds./game passing and 197 yds./game rushing in 2015, so I'm not sure where the 2 yards and a cloud of dust is coming from. They will have a new QB and 3 new OL so I would be more inclined to try blitzing more to confuse them. Their defense was bad last year, especially DB, but most of their defense is back and they expect to be better.

    I expect our offense to struggle, so the defense will have to keep us in the game.
